Application of anodic oxidation aluminum gloss detection

The purpose of measuring the gloss of anodized aluminum is to evaluate its appearance quality and material characteristics, because gloss is one of the important indicators to characterize the smoothness, reflection ability and texture of anodized aluminum surface. The surface of high-gloss anodized aluminum is smooth, bright, good reflective performance, and fine surface texture, which can improve its aesthetics and texture, thereby enhancing its market competitiveness. At the same time, the high-gloss anodized aluminum surface also has better wear resistance, corrosion resistance and oxidation resistance, which can better protect its surface and prolong its service life. Low-gloss anodized aluminum may exhibit a more earthy, natural style, suitable for some specific applications. Measuring the gloss of anodized aluminum can also help manufacturers monitor production quality, discover problems in the production process in time, and make improvements and adjustments to ensure product stability and consistency.

Measurement steps

The gloss meter can be used to measure the gloss of anodized aluminum. Here are the steps to measure:

Prepare the sample: Take a sample of anodized aluminum and make sure the surface of the sample is clean and free of dust.

Calibrate the gloss meter: calibrate according to the manual of the gloss meter to ensure accurate measurement.

Set the gloss meter: according to the characteristics of the sample and the model of the gloss meter, set the parameters of the gloss meter, such as the measurement angle and the type of light source.

Measure the sample: place the gloss meter vertically on the surface of the sample, and press the measurement button. After a short wait, the gloss meter will display the gloss value of the sample.

Repeated measurement: In order to ensure the accuracy of the measurement results, it is recommended to measure the same sample several times and take the average value as the final result.
